📝 Ingredients
Strained Yogurt: Grade a Pasteurized Milk and Cream, Live Active Yogurt Cultures (l. Bulgaricus, S. Thermophilus, L. Acidophilus, Bifidus, L. Casei). Peach Fruit Preparation (20%): Peaches, Cane Sugar, Water, Corn Starch, Contains 2% or Less of: Lemon Juice Concentrate, Natural Flavor.
